
When considering whether fresh corn on the cob should be refrigerated, it’s essential to understand how storage affects its sweetness and texture. Fresh corn is best consumed as soon as possible after harvesting, as its natural sugars begin to convert into starch, making it less sweet over time. Refrigeration can help slow this process, preserving the corn’s flavor and crispness for a few days. However, improper refrigeration, such as storing it in airtight containers or for too long, can lead to moisture buildup and spoilage. Ultimately, refrigeration is recommended for fresh corn on the cob if it cannot be eaten immediately, but it’s crucial to consume it within 1-2 days for the best quality.

Storage Timeframe: How long can fresh corn stay unrefrigerated before spoiling?
Fresh corn on the cob is highly perishable due to its natural sugars, which begin converting to starch immediately after harvest. Left unrefrigerated, this process accelerates, causing the corn to lose sweetness and texture. At room temperature (68–72°F), fresh corn will start to deteriorate within 6–8 hours, with noticeable changes in flavor and firmness by the 12-hour mark. For optimal quality, refrigeration is recommended, but understanding the unrefrigerated window is crucial for short-term storage or immediate use.
The storage timeframe for unrefrigerated corn depends on humidity and air circulation. In a cool, dry environment, corn can last up to 24 hours before spoilage becomes evident. However, in warm or humid conditions (above 75°F), spoilage accelerates, and the corn may become unusable within 4–6 hours. To maximize unrefrigerated time, store corn in a well-ventilated area, such as a pantry or countertop, and avoid plastic bags, which trap moisture and promote mold growth.
For those who prioritize flavor, the unrefrigerated window is a delicate balance. While refrigeration preserves sweetness for 3–5 days, unrefrigerated corn begins losing its peak quality after 8 hours. If you plan to cook corn within this timeframe, leaving it unrefrigerated is acceptable, but expect a slight decline in taste and texture. For longer storage, refrigeration is non-negotiable, as it slows enzymatic activity and sugar conversion.
Practical tip: If you’re harvesting or purchasing corn and can’t refrigerate it immediately, keep it in its husk to retain moisture and protect against environmental factors. Once shucked, unrefrigerated corn should be cooked or refrigerated promptly. For outdoor events like picnics, transport corn in a cooler with ice packs to extend its freshness, as exposure to heat drastically shortens its unrefrigerated lifespan.
In summary, fresh corn on the cob can stay unrefrigerated for 6–24 hours, depending on temperature and humidity. While short-term unrefrigerated storage is feasible, it’s a trade-off between convenience and quality. For the best results, refrigerate corn promptly or cook it within the first 8 hours to enjoy its natural sweetness and crispness.

Refrigeration Benefits: Does chilling corn preserve its sweetness and texture effectively?
Fresh corn on the cob is a summer staple, but its sweetness can fade quickly after harvest. Refrigeration is often touted as a way to preserve this delicate flavor, but does it truly deliver? The answer lies in understanding the science behind corn's sugar conversion. Corn's natural sugars begin transforming into starch the moment it's picked, a process accelerated by warmth. Chilling significantly slows this conversion, effectively locking in sweetness for a limited time.
Refrigeration acts as a pause button, buying you 1-3 days of peak flavor. For optimal results, store unhusked corn in the coldest part of your refrigerator, ideally at 32°F (0°C). Husked corn should be wrapped tightly in plastic to prevent moisture loss, which can lead to shriveled kernels and a tougher texture.
While refrigeration preserves sweetness, its impact on texture is more nuanced. Cold temperatures can firm up kernels slightly, which some find desirable for a satisfying bite. However, prolonged refrigeration (beyond 3-4 days) can lead to a slight softening, particularly in supersweet varieties. To minimize this, consume chilled corn promptly or consider blanching before refrigeration. Briefly boiling or steaming corn for 2-3 minutes, followed by an ice bath, halts enzyme activity responsible for starch conversion and textural changes.
The effectiveness of refrigeration hinges on timing and technique. For corn consumed within 24 hours of harvest, refrigeration offers minimal benefit, as its natural sugars remain stable at room temperature. However, for corn purchased from markets or picked later in the day, chilling becomes crucial. Remember, refrigeration is a temporary solution. For longer storage, consider freezing or canning, which halt sugar conversion entirely but alter texture significantly.
Ultimately, refrigeration is a valuable tool for extending the sweetness and freshness of corn on the cob, but it's a delicate balance. Use it strategically, prioritizing prompt consumption for the best results.

Optimal Storage Tips: Best practices for storing corn to maintain freshness longer
Fresh corn on the cob is best stored in the refrigerator, but only if you can't cook and consume it immediately. Leaving it at room temperature accelerates sugar conversion to starch, making it less sweet. If you must wait before cooking, refrigerate the corn in its husk to retain moisture and delay sugar loss. This method buys you up to two days of peak freshness, though the sooner you cook it, the better.
To maximize freshness, avoid removing the husk until just before cooking. The husk acts as a natural insulator, protecting the kernels from drying out. If you’ve already shucked the corn, wrap it tightly in damp paper towels or a plastic bag before refrigerating. This mimics the husk’s moisture-retaining properties and slows down dehydration. For unshucked corn, store it in a plastic bag to prevent the refrigerator’s dry air from penetrating.
Freezing is an excellent option if you have excess corn and want to extend its shelf life beyond a few days. Blanch the ears in boiling water for 4–6 minutes, then plunge them into ice water to halt cooking. Once cooled, pat them dry, wrap each ear tightly in plastic wrap or aluminum foil, and place them in a freezer bag. Properly frozen corn can last up to a year without significant loss of flavor or texture.
For those who prefer convenience, consider cutting the kernels off the cob and storing them in airtight containers or freezer bags. This method saves space and makes the corn ready for quick use in soups, salads, or stir-fries. Whether refrigerated or frozen, always label containers with the storage date to track freshness. By following these practices, you can enjoy sweet, tender corn long after its harvest season.

Freezing vs. Refrigerating: Which method better preserves corn’s quality over time?
Fresh corn on the cob is a summer staple, but its sweetness and tenderness begin to deteriorate within hours of harvest. To extend its shelf life, refrigeration and freezing are the primary methods, each with distinct impacts on texture, flavor, and convenience. Refrigeration slows enzymatic activity and microbial growth, preserving corn’s crispness and natural sugars for 1–3 days. Freezing, however, halts these processes almost entirely, allowing corn to retain its quality for up to 12 months. The choice between the two depends on how quickly you plan to use the corn and how much effort you’re willing to invest.
Steps for Refrigeration:
- Leave the husks on to retain moisture.
- Place the corn in a plastic bag to prevent drying.
- Store in the crisper drawer at 32–35°F (0–2°C).
Steps for Freezing:
- Blanch ears in boiling water for 4–6 minutes to deactivate enzymes.
- Plunge into ice water for 4 minutes to stop cooking.
- Remove kernels or freeze whole cobs in airtight bags or containers.
